Na początku tego tygodnia inżynierowie z Aloha Browser zgłosili nowy błąd, który jest plagą większości produktów Apple. Błąd, który jest spowodowany przez określony znak telugu, powoduje awarię aplikacji, gdy znak zostanie wstawiony do pola tekstowego. Raport o błędzie społeczności Open Radar w tej sprawie stwierdza, że kiedy iOS, MacOS, watchOS, tvOS próbują wyrenderować znak telugu, jeśli jest on wstawiony do dowolnego systemu renderowania tekstu, powoduje to awarię aplikacji.
Otworzyłem nowy poważny błąd, dotykając wszystkich produktów Apple. Jeśli spróbujesz wstawić jakiś indyjski symbol do systemu renderowania tekstu, spowoduje to awarię aplikacji. Odtwarzalne na iOS, Mac OS, tvOS, watchOS. Sprawdź to.
RT: @steipete @LisaDziuba @johnsundell https://t.co/KLtA2tkMJj- Igor (@igorbaum) 12 lutego 2018
Aloha Browser później napisał na Twitterze, że problem wydaje się być związany z czcionką San Francisco, która jest używana domyślnie na większości urządzeń Apple. Ponadto Aloha Browser twierdziła, że to nie tylko jeden znak telugu wywołuje błąd, ale dwa, a mianowicie 0xC1C i 0xC1E. Znaki telugu w tłumaczeniu oznaczają słowo „znak”. Wiadomości zawierające symbole telugu mogą skutecznie wyłączyć każdą aplikację do czatu lub poczty e-mail, która próbuje je renderować.
Pierwotnie to nasz zespół zgłosił to do OpenRadar. Po dokładniejszym zbadaniu znaleźliśmy dwa symbole, nie tylko ten. Jak najszybciej zgłoszono błąd firmie Apple.
- Aloha Browser (@alohabrowser) 15 lutego 2018
Błąd został pomyślnie odtworzony na iOS, macOS, tvOS i watchOS, chociaż kilka komentarzy do raportu o błędzie społeczności sugeruje, że nie wszystkie urządzenia są dotknięte błędem. PCMag informuje, że symbole telugu nie wydają się wywoływać żadnego błędu, gdy są wyświetlane przez przeglądarkę. Jeśli jednak symbol zostanie skopiowany i wklejony w polu tekstowym, spowoduje to awarię odpowiedniej aplikacji.
Apple podobno pracuje nad wprowadzeniem poprawki, która ma wkrótce zostać uruchomiona. Warto zauważyć, że błąd nie dotyczy wersji beta iOS, macOS, watchOS i tvOS, co sugeruje, że firma już opracowała poprawkę i ma pojawić się wcześniej niż później. Firma miała zły tydzień problemów z oprogramowaniem tuż przed końcem zeszłego roku i chociaż firma pracuje nad rozwiązaniem wszystkich problemów, problemy po prostu nie przestają się pojawiać.